ubuntu MySQL采用apt-get install安装目录情况

本文介绍了如何在Ubuntu系统中安装MySQL服务器及客户端,并详细展示了安装过程中所使用的命令。此外,还提供了MySQL在Ubuntu系统中的常见文件布局说明,包括配置文件、数据库文件、日志文件等的位置。
安装服务器:
root@ubuntu:/# apt-get install mysql-server-5.5
安装客户端:
root@ubuntu:/# apt-get install mysql-client-core-5.5
 
一). ubuntu下mysql安装布局:
/usr/bin                      客户端 程序和mysql_install_db
/var/lib/mysql            数据库和日志文件
/var/run/mysqld        服务器
/etc/mysql               配置文件my.cnf
/usr/share/mysql       字符集,基准程序和错误消息
/etc/init.d/mysql        启动mysql服务器
Ubuntu 系统中,MySQL 官方 APT 仓库默认仅提供最新版本的安装包。因此,直接使用 `apt` 命令安装 MySQL 5.7 版本时需要手动添加旧版本的仓库源。然而,对于 MySQL 8.0 的安装,可以沿用类似的命令结构和流程,只需不指定版本号即可,默认会安装最新的稳定版。 ### 安装步骤 1. **下载并添加 MySQL APT 仓库** 访问 [MySQL APT Repository 下载页面](https://dev.mysql.com/downloads/repo/apt/) 获取适用于 Ubuntu 的 `.deb` 包,并通过以下命令进行安装: ```bash wget https://dev.mysql.com/get/mysql-apt-config_0.8.24-1_all.deb sudo dpkg -i mysql-apt-config_0.8.24-1_all.deb ``` 在配置过程中,可以选择 MySQL 服务器的版本。若希望安装 MySQL 8.0,则无需更改默认选项,直接确认即可[^2]。 2. **更新软件包索引** 添加仓库后,运行以下命令以更新系统中的软件包列表: ```bash sudo apt update ``` 3. **安装 MySQL 8.0 服务** 使用如下命令安装 MySQL 8.0 服务端及客户端工具: ```bash sudo apt install -y mysql-server mysql-client ``` 此过程会自动安装 MySQL 8.0 的最新版本,包括必要的依赖项。 4. **设置 root 密码** 安装完成后,系统会提示用户设置 `root` 用户密码。此密码可任意设定,但建议选择一个强密码以增强数据库安全性[^1]。 5. **验证安装** 安装结束后,可以通过以下命令检查 MySQL 是否成功启动: ```bash sudo systemctl status mysql ``` 若服务处于运行状态,则表示安装成功。 6. **配置文件调整(可选)** 如果需要将 MySQL 8.0 的行为调整为更接近 MySQL 5.7,可以在 `/etc/mysql/my.cnf` 或 `/etc/mysql/mysql.conf.d/mysqld.cnf` 文件中进行修改。例如,为了保持与旧客户端兼容性,可以添加以下行: ```ini [mysqld] default_authentication_plugin=mysql_native_password ``` 此外,如果希望保留 `latin1` 字符集作为默认字符集,也可以在配置文件中添加相应的设置。 7. **重启 MySQL 服务** 修改配置文件后,需重启 MySQL 服务使更改生效: ```bash sudo systemctl restart mysql ``` ---
评论
成就一亿技术人!
拼手气红包6.0元
还能输入1000个字符
 
红包 添加红包
表情包 插入表情
 条评论被折叠 查看
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值